The Science Behind Cryolipolysis
Cryolipolysis is a method that involves freezing fat cells to help with weight loss goals effectively and naturally by cooling the specific area of the body being treated to a low enough temperature using a specialized applicator that freezes the fat cells in the process; as a result of this freezing effect these fat cells become inactive and eventually break down due to their inability to survive in extremely cold conditions This gradual breakdown of frozen fat cells allows the body to naturally absorb and eliminate them through its metabolic processes over time resulting in a decrease, in fat accumulation.

Comparing Cryolipolysis with Other Slimming Methods
Compared to the liposuction surgery method cryolipolysis offers multiple benefits wherein it does not involve any surgical procedures or downtime for recovery like liposuction does. Moreover cryolipolysis targets problematic areas unlike diet and exercise which focus on overall weight loss which makes it an attractive choice, for individuals seeking to shape certain areas of their body effectively.

Considerations Before Choosing a Slimming Cryolipolysis Machine
Suitability for Different Body Types
When deciding whether to use a cryolipolysis machine it’s important to assess how well it works for various body shapes and sizes. A cryo-lipolysis machine is created to focus attention on body parts like the stomach waist hips and arms. This quality makes it good for people who want to target fat areas that are hard to get rid of using normal weight loss techniques. Nonetheless, certain body types may not react in the way, to cryolipolysis treatment. Various elements like the flexibility of your skin or how fat is distributed across your body can impact how well the treatment works for you in cryolipolysis procedures. Because of the importance and complexity involved in matters such as body composition and skin anatomy differing from person to person, it’s essential to seek guidance from a certified expert who can evaluate your specific requirements and ascertain if cryolipolysis is the suitable option for you.
